What You Should Know – About The Dirty Dozen, The 15 Clean, Vegetable And Fruits – To Stay Safe

Always, always, wash your fruits and vegetables.

The reason is that many have pesticides and other dangerous chemicals on that that are harmful to your health.

And there is a simple, simple, way that is easy and effective – place your fruits and or vegetables in a strainer and then run cold water over them for a minute or so.

The Dirty Dozen In Order

  1. Strawberries
  2. Spinach 
  3. Kale, collard, and mustard greens
  4. Grapes
  5. Peaches
  6. Pears
  7. Nectarines
  8. Apples
  9. Bell and hot peppers
  10. Cherries
  11. Blueberries
  12. Green beans

The 15 Clean In Order

  1. Avocados
  2. Sweet corn
  3. Pineapple
  4. Onions 
  5. Papaya
  6. Sweet peas (frozen)
  7. Asparagus
  8. Honeydew melons
  9. Kiwi
  10. Cabbages
  11. Watermelon
  12. Mushrooms
  13. Mangoes
  14. Sweet potatoes
  15. Carrots
